Ingredients
- 200g Oak Smoked Salmon
- 200g Cream Cheese
- 2 tbsp lemon juice
- Caper berries
- 1 tbsp chopped Fresh Dill
- Salt and pepper to taste
-
Keto Seeded Bread (round cut)
Instructions
- Roughly chop the smoked salmon.
- Place the smoked salmon, cream cheese, lemon juice, and dill in a food processor.
- Blend until smooth and creamy.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Transfer to a bowl and refrigerate for at least an hour before serving.
- Place into a food presentation ring on top of the bread and fill about 2 inches high.
- Carefully lift the ring of and top with extra smoked salmon, caper berries.
- Serve with extra bread and butter slices and top with fresh dill.
